What is a Loadmaster (Air Cargo) degree?

A Loadmaster in air cargo is a specialized professional responsible for the safe and efficient loading and unloading of cargo on aircraft. They ensure that weight and balance requirements are met, which is crucial for flight safety and performance. Loadmasters work in various contexts, including commercial airlines, cargo carriers, and military operations. As air cargo continues to grow in importance for global trade, the role of a Loadmaster becomes increasingly vital. Career paths and job opportunities

  • Air Cargo Loadmaster - Responsible for planning and supervising the loading of cargo to ensure safety and compliance with regulations.
  • Flight Operations Coordinator - Manages flight schedules and coordinates cargo handling to optimize efficiency.
  • Ground Operations Supervisor - Oversees ground crew activities, ensuring that cargo is loaded and unloaded correctly and safely.
  • Logistics Specialist - Plans and implements logistics strategies to enhance cargo transportation processes.
  • Cargo Handler - Physically loads and unloads cargo, following instructions from the Loadmaster regarding weight distribution.
  • Airline Safety Officer - Ensures compliance with safety regulations and protocols during cargo operations.

Key skills and competencies

  • Weight and Balance Calculation - Ability to accurately calculate the weight distribution of cargo for safe flight operations.
  • Regulatory Knowledge - Understanding of aviation regulations and safety standards governing air cargo transport.
  • Problem-Solving - Capacity to quickly address and resolve issues that arise during cargo loading and unloading.
  • Communication - Strong verbal and written skills to effectively coordinate with flight crews and ground personnel.
  • Attention to Detail - Meticulousness in following procedures to ensure safety and compliance.

Job market and 2026 outlook

The demand for Loadmasters is projected to grow significantly, driven by the increasing reliance on air cargo for global supply chains. According to industry reports, the air cargo market is expected to expand by 4% annually through 2026. Regions with the highest demand include North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ific, where e-commerce and logistics companies are expanding their operations. The integration of AI technologies in cargo management is also expected to enhance operational efficiency, creating new opportunities for skilled Loadmasters.
